Potential Burglary Ring Targeting Small Businesses in Prince William County

Four businesses in Woodbridge, Virginia, have been burglarized in a possible crime ring, according to Prince William County Police.

La Despensa Familiar Grocery, Marumsco Cleaners on Route 1, a Pizza Hut at Dillingham Square and Prime Cuts Barber Shop on Potomac Mills Road suffered from what police call a “smash and grab burglary,” Prince William County Police said.

At La Despensa Familiar Grocery, the cash register was destroyed and all the money taken, police said. In the process, a burglar cut himself, leaving behind some blood, and was caught on one of the store's many surveillance cameras.

At Marumsco Cleaners, a shopping cart was used to smash the front door, police said. The cash register with all the money inside was stolen, according to John Yang, owner of the cleaners.

At the Pizza Hut, the cash register was stolen as well, police said.

At Prime Cuts Barber Shop Saturday morning, the door was found smashed, the cash register was broken, and all the money had been taken, according to Frank Torres, owner of the shop. The back office was also damaged, police said.

Police are uncertain if the burglaries are a one man operation or a burglary ring targeting small businesses. Police ask anyone with knowledge about the burglaries to come forward.
